WebIn the modern periodic table, elements are arranged by increasing atomic number. Describe the periodic law. Properties of elements repeat in a predictable way when atomic numbers are used to arrange elements into groups. What 2 factors determine the atomic mass of an element? Web3 de out. de 2024 · Here's a helpful table chronicling the discovery of the elements. The date is listed for when the element was first isolated. In many cases, the presence of a new element was suspected years or even thousands of years before it could be purified.
